Diagnosis of Flow Characteristics in Wind Farm using the Numerical Model "RIAM-COMPACT"

2006 
We are developing the numerical model called the RIAM-COMPACT (Research Institute for Applied Mechanics, Kyushu University, Computational Prediction of Airflow over Complex Terrain). The object domain of this numerical model is from several m to several km, and can predict the airflow and the gas diffusion over complex terrain with high precision. The spread to the market has already been begun by three enterprise companies. The estimation of the annual electrical power output is also possible now based on the observation data. In the present study, wind simulation of an actual wind farm was executed using the high resolution elevation data. As a result, a suitable point for wind power generation and an improper point were clarified. This cause was found to be a change in slight ups and downs of geographical features.
